Setup Guide
1. Unboxing and Initial Placement
Carefully remove the TV and soundbar from their packaging. The TV is lightweight, making handling easier. Choose a stable, flat surface for placement or prepare for wall mounting. Ensure adequate ventilation around the TV.
2. Connecting the TV
- Power: Connect the TV's power cord to a wall outlet.
- External Devices (Optional): Use HDMI cables to connect devices such as game consoles, cable boxes, or Blu-ray players to the available HDMI ports on the TV. The TV typically has three HDMI ports.
3. Connecting the Soundbar
The Roku TV Wireless Soundbar connects wirelessly to your Roku TV, simplifying setup.
- Power: Plug the soundbar's power cord into a wall outlet.
- Pairing: Follow the on-screen prompts on your Roku TV to pair the soundbar. This process is typically automatic or guided through the TV's settings menu.
4. Initial Setup Wizard
Upon first power-on, the TV will guide you through the initial setup process:
- Language Selection: Choose your preferred language.
- Network Connection: Connect to your home Wi-Fi network. Ensure you have your network name (SSID) and password ready.
- Roku Account: You will be prompted to link or create a Roku account. This is essential for accessing streaming channels and features.
- Channel Scan (Optional): If connecting an antenna, the TV will scan for available over-the-air channels.
- App Installation: The TV will automatically install popular streaming apps. You can add more from the Streaming Store later.
Operating Instructions
1. Remote Control Overview
The included Roku remote is designed for simplicity and ease of use. It features essential navigation buttons, volume controls, and dedicated quick-access buttons for popular streaming services. The remote also supports voice commands for searching content and controlling the TV. Note that it does not include a traditional number pad for direct channel input.
2. Navigating the Roku Interface
- Home Screen: The central hub for all your entertainment. It displays your installed streaming channels, input selections (HDMI, Antenna), and recommended content.
- Customization: You can rearrange the order of your channels on the home screen to prioritize your most used apps.
- Search: Use the search function (often accessible via voice command or a dedicated button) to find movies, TV shows, actors, or specific channels across all your installed services.
- Streaming Store: Browse and add new streaming channels from the Roku Channel Store.
3. Streaming Content
Access your favorite streaming services by selecting their icons from the home screen. Many services require a subscription, while Roku also offers a wide selection of free content through the Roku Channel and other free apps.
4. Sound Settings
The Roku TV and Wireless Soundbar system offers various audio enhancements:
- Volume Leveling: Automatically reduces the volume of loud commercials to maintain a consistent listening experience.
- Speech Clarity: Boosts the volume of voices to make dialogue clearer and easier to understand.
- Night Mode: Optimizes sound for quiet listening, reducing sudden loud noises while keeping dialogue audible.
- These settings can typically be adjusted within the TV's audio settings menu.
5. Connecting External Devices
To switch between connected devices (e.g., game console, cable box), select the corresponding HDMI input from the Roku home screen. The TV automatically detects active inputs.
Maintenance
1. Cleaning
- Screen: Gently wipe the screen with a soft, dry microfiber cloth. For stubborn smudges, slightly dampen the cloth with water or a screen-specific cleaning solution (do not spray directly on the screen).
- Body and Soundbar: Use a soft, dry cloth to wipe dust from the TV frame and soundbar. Avoid abrasive cleaners or solvents.
- Always unplug the TV and soundbar before cleaning.
2. Software Updates
Your Roku TV automatically receives software updates when connected to the internet. These updates provide new features, performance improvements, and security enhancements. Ensure your TV remains connected to the internet to receive these updates.
Troubleshooting
If you encounter issues with your Roku TV or Wireless Soundbar, try the following common solutions:
| Problem | Solution |
|---|---|
| No Power / TV Not Turning On | Ensure the power cord is securely plugged into both the TV/soundbar and a working wall outlet. Try a different outlet. |
| No Picture / Black Screen | Verify the correct input source is selected on the Roku home screen. Check HDMI cable connections. Restart the TV by unplugging it for 30 seconds and plugging it back in. |
| No Sound from TV or Soundbar | Check volume levels on both the TV and soundbar. Ensure the soundbar is properly paired with the TV. Verify audio settings in the TV menu. If using external devices, check their audio output settings. |
| Wi-Fi Connection Issues | Restart your Wi-Fi router. Go to the TV's network settings and re-enter your Wi-Fi password. Ensure the TV is within range of your router. |
| Remote Control Not Responding | Replace the batteries in the remote. Ensure there are no obstructions between the remote and the TV. Re-pair the remote if it's a voice remote (follow on-screen instructions or consult Roku support). |
